Key Features

All-Welded Steel Construction

Offers excellent strength and vibration resistance, making it ideal for extreme industrial conditions and high-speed applications.

Multistage Compression Design

Enables the generation of stable high pressures with minimal pulsation, thanks to precision-balanced impellers in series.

Modular Impeller Staging

Up to 10 or more stages can be configured depending on required pressure and flow output.

Customizable Shaft Seals and Bearings

Adaptable to application-specific requirements (mechanical seals, labyrinth seals, water-cooled or oil-lubricated bearings).

Precision Machining and Dynamic Balancing

Ensures low vibration, longer life, and high efficiency even under continuous heavy-load operation.

Technical Specifications

Parameter Range
Flow Rate 5 – 300 m³/min
Pressure Rise 50 – 250 kPa (or more)
Number of Stages 2 – 10+
Impeller Speed Up to 15,000 RPM
Impeller Material Welded Steel or Stainless Steel
Drive Type Direct coupling or belt drive
Cooling Method Air or water cooling

Applications of C Series Centrifugal Blowers

The C Series Welded Centrifugal Blowers are highly versatile and suited for a wide array of industrial applications where custom airflow and pressure profiles are critical:

🌊 Municipal & Industrial Wastewater Treatment

Deep tank aeration, activated sludge systems

🔥 Combustion & Kiln Air Supply

Cement plants, glass manufacturing, incineration units

🛢️ Petrochemical & Oil Refining

Catalyst regeneration, tail gas treatment, flare systems

🧪 Chemical & Fertilizer Production

Process air for reactors, gas circulation

⚡ Power Generation

Boiler feed air, flue gas treatment

📦 Pneumatic Conveying Systems

For powders, granules, or ash handling in cement and mining industries
